Rockefeller Center Christmas tree lights up for holidays
  • 5 years ago
In New York City, the Rockefeller Center Christmas tree lighting up is a sign of the holiday season in full force. AccuWeather reporter Kena Vernon is in New York to hear from tourists enjoying the sight.
Recommended